## Environments

Liftsim (our elevator-dispatch simulator) runs in three flavors: sandbox, staging, and live. Plugin authors should stick to sandbox — it resets nightly and won't mind if your dispatch algorithm sends every car to the penthouse at once. Staging mirrors live traffic patterns, so request access only when you're ready for a real soak test. All three environments share the same API surface but different tuning. The sandbox values you'll be working against are these.

deployment values, kajep-kageg:
[praix]
host = praix.paliqcorp.corp
user = praix_svc
database = praix_prod

### FAQ: Why does my plugin's deep link open the wrong screen?

Deep links in the Lanternfall SDK are routed through a central manifest, not your plugin's own scheme. If your link lands on the home screen, your route prefix likely isn't registered in the manifest the host app shipped with. Register the prefix through the plugin portal, then rebuild. During review, you'll be asked to unlock the sandbox routing console, which requires the shared recovery passphrase shown below.

unlock words, hahip-baduf: holwyn-istath-julvan

Since Tuesday's Norwood cluster upgrade, the internal `tailcat` log-tailing CLI drops connections roughly every 10 minutes with `stream reset by peer`. Reproduced on three workstations; the web console is unaffected, so this looks client-side. Suspect the CLI pins an outdated TLS cipher list rejected by the new gateway. Workaround for this week: use the console or pipe through `tailcat --compat`. For the sync, note that `tailcat` also reads session metadata directly from the ops database via the string below.

replica DSN, kajep-yahag: mssql://praok_svc:iF@db-8d68.plorvaio.local:5432/eliion

Current state: column-mapping UI is done, validation runs server-side, and malformed rows are quarantined rather than rejected outright. Outstanding security items: the file-size cap is enforced only client-side, and uploaded files sit unencrypted in the staging bucket for up to 24 hours. Dela started a threat-model doc but hasn't finished the injection section. Before sign-off, please review the sanitization rules for formula-prefixed cells. The threat model and test corpus live on the internal page here.

operations page: https://jenkins.zemvarcloud.local/job/merge_requests/repo/build/73930b4b30f0a8ed